Get A Job!

In response to the increasing presence of corporate nasties at our universities, there has been a recent flurry of actions at various careers’ fairs and talks. In Manchester, one person cuffed themselves to a British Aerospace display to make sure he could stay and inform everyone of the sordid truth about BAe. This was followed by disruption at a swanky Shell affair where activists offered attendants ‘Who Wants to be a Millionaire’, with a carrot, a tenner and even £20 available for the correct answers about Shell’s ethical policies! In Newcastle, students attending a Nestle careers presentation were treated to an alternative perspective of the company by protesters. Feeling the students were generally not interested in Nestle’s exploitative policies the group left in the interval (after reclaiming choccie freebies to give to local kids homes).
